7. Honey-Glazed Roasted Carrots
Credit: @platingsandpairings

Fall is root vegetable season, and roasted carrots shine when caramelized in the oven. Their natural sweetness deepens as they roast. Level up the warmth using herbs and spices such as cumin, coriander, thyme, and rosemary.

Drizzling some honey as they finish cooking takes them over the top. They’re simple, rustic, and perfect for cool-weather meals.

9. Mushroom Risotto
Credit: @damn_delicious

Earthy mushrooms and creamy rice make this risotto a fall favorite. The slow cooking brings out rich flavors that feel indulgent and warming. Use a variety of mushrooms such as shiitake, oyster, chanterelle, and beech.

Be generous with the Pecorino cheese as well! Every spoonful is creamy, savory, and satisfying—like autumn in comfort food form.

14. Roasted Brussels Sprouts
Credit: @reciperunner

Crispy on the outside and tender on the inside, roasted Brussels sprouts are peak fall flavor. Cut them in half for maximum surface area. They’ll crisp up nicely as they bake.  

Add balsamic glaze or Parmesan to take them up a notch. They’re simple but packed with seasonal goodness.
